FAIL Blog
Advertisement

church

Untitled

church drama - 3119005952

Untitled

billboard church god innuendo jesus christ sex signs - 2967738624
Created by amphigory2e
Advertisement

Untitled

adult novelty store books church reading van - 2901222400
See all captions
Advertisement

Hot Today

Advertisement